  • I’m excited to launch this signature guitar because it embodies all the features I’ve loved in the Double Cuts I play along with a new thinner and resonant body. I’ve spent my life dedicated to music education. The fact that creating this instrument also allows me to raise money for the Save the Music Foundation was the final incentive I needed to want to be involved.
    This is a unique guitar that was built for a unique and timely cause. I hope you love it as much as I do.
